INTRODUCTION
We are seeking a full-time Product Quality Analyst at Garmin's U.S. headquarters in the Greater Kansas City area. In this role, you will be responsible for managing and driving the investigation of field quality issues to facilitate product quality improvements.
Responsibilities
Essential Functions:
- Exercise independent judgment to ensure field issues are documented to an appropriate level based on the analysis of the complexity and potential severity of the issue by working with the issue reporter and field interfacing teams/roles
- Determine a path for issue investigation through engineering groups and business organizations
- Identify, analyze and interpret product quality data to assess issue criticality and guide issue investigation and resolution
- Interpret and analyze engineering responses to issues and determine if further investigation is required or additional information is needed
- Formulate the appropriate communication for issue resolution status and work with business organizations to determine and take appropriate mitigation action based on the impact to the customer and business
- Identify and implement process enhancements for managing field issues
- Develop and deliver quality reports to the project teams as well as lead issue review and prioritization meetings
- Provide analytic support in connection with the development and implementation of quality tools to aid in data management and issue resolution
BASIC QUALIFICATIONS
- Associate's Degree or equivalent from two-year college or technical school OR an equivalent combination of education and relevant experience
- Excellent academics (cumulative GPA greater than or equal to 3.0 as a general rule)
- Demonstrated analytical experience
- Demonstrated experience handling escalated customer issues
- Demonstrated success in solving difficult problems
- Excellent time management, follow-up and analytical skills with keen attention to detail
- Working knowledge of Garmin products
- Demonstrated ability to work across functional and organizational boundaries
- Demonstrated strong and effective verbal, written, and interpersonal communication skills
- Demonstrated flexibility and a commitment to meeting deadlines
- Demonstrated ability to deal with confidential company matters
- Demonstrated proficient computer skills in Microsoft Word, Excel, and Powerpoint
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
- 5+ years relevant experience
- Working knowledge of Microsoft Access and SQL
- Previous exposure to data analysis and quality assurance methodology

What Kansas Employers Look For
The qualifications that appear most often in quality analyst jobs across Kansas.
- Experience writing and executing test cases, test plans, and defect reports
- Proficiency with bug tracking and test management tools such as Jira or TestRail
- Knowledge of QA methodologies including functional, regression, and UAT testing
- Bachelor's degree in computer science, engineering, or a related technical field
- Familiarity with Agile and Scrum development workflows
- ASQ, ISTQB, or ISO 9001 certification preferred or required for regulated industries

How much do quality analysts make in Kansas?
Quality analysts in Kansas earn a median of about $39,930 a year, based on May 2025 Bureau of Labor Statistics wage data, ranging from around $33,390 for the lowest 10% to over $71,320 for the top 10%. Pay rises with experience, specialty, and employer.
